Flying helicopters in Bali, Indonesia. Paradise, right? It can be. But dropping half-ton sling loads into jungle clearings with no margin for error calls for skilful flying and a lot of trust. Heli SGI have been doing it for over 16 years. Heli SGI operate a fleet of several Bell helicopters, including the Bell 206, Bell 407 and the Eagle 407HP. Their medium fleet comprises of a Bell 212 and a Bell 412. They operate tourist flights in Bali, and provide helicopter support to mining operations across Indonesia by flying underslung loads with mining equipment into remote areas of the mountains and jungle. Heli SGI pilots are highly skilled, but they depend on engineers and technicians to keep the helicopters flying. Heli SGI train graduates to conduct line and depth maintenance on helicopters, and have a apprenticeship programs recruiting from local colleges. Over 90% of their technicians are Indonesian.
